使用web.py驱动MSSQL数据库的开发之旅(web.py mssql)


随着互联网技术的不断发展,在网络应用开发中,数据库的运用占了很重要的地位。在网页的开发中,MSSQL数据库可以提供可靠、高效的数据存储服务,因此使用web.py框架来开发后台管理系统已经成为一种新的趋势。本文将介绍如何使用web.py驱动MSSQL数据库。

首先,需要准备安装好Microsoft SQL Server 2019或更高版本的安装包。接下来,在MSSQL新建一个用户,为了方便,可以让其身份是sysadmin,然后在数据库中创建一个数据库。其次,要安装web.py框架,使用命令即可:pip install web.py。安装完成后,可以编写程序代码,来实现读写数据库的功能。

以下是web.py连接SQL Server的示例代码:

import web

# 连接字符串
db_conn_str = 'DRIVER={SQL Server};SERVER=127.0.0.1;DATABASE=your_database;UID=sa;PWD=sa@123'

# 连接
db = web.database(dbn='mssql', db=db_conn_str)

# 执行查询(该语句查出Person表中的所有记录)
res = db.query('SELECT * FROM Person')

# 输出结果
for r in res:
print("Id = ", r.Id, ", Name = ", r.Name)

上述的代码实现的是数据库的查询,为了进行增删改操作,可以编写如下代码:

#  插入记录 
db.insert('Person', Id = '001', Name = 'Jane')

# 更新记录
db.update('Person', where = 'Id = 001', Name = 'Mark')

# 删除记录
db.delete('Person', where = 'Id = 001')

综上所述,使用web.py开发MSSQL管理系统并不难,只要一些简单的代码即可轻松实现。此外,web.py的优势还在于开发过程不仅速度快,而且省去了很多无谓的配置,是一款非常适合开发MSSQL应用的技术框架。